'Law & Order: SVU' Explores Own "Persona"
Tuesday, November 25, 2008
             
Law & Order: SVUThis week, Law & Order: Special Victims Unit lays off the musicians-as-guest-stars trend, if only for a while.  Two weeks ago we saw Jesse McCartney take on the role of a murder suspect, which is a surprise considering the image we’ve had of him, both as a singer and actor, for the longest time.  Last week, we saw OutKast’s Big Boi take on the role of a, well, hip hop artist who aids the team with uncovering an animal smuggling ring, and it was an easier thing to believe, if you look at it one way.

Tonight, things are going to be back to how it was ought to be.  Not that I’m saying musicians can’t be actors, and vice versa; it’s just a little unusual, really.  Tonight’s SVU is entitled “Persona”, and it is a return to roots, of sorts, for the long-running crime series.  Olivia Benson (Mariska Hargitay) handles a cast of spousal abuse: Mia Lorimer (guest star Clea Duvall, Carnivàle) claims that she was raped in an attempt to hide from her husband Brett (guest star Nathaniel Marston, One Life to Live).

Everything actually goes well—Mia eventually confesses to being beaten up, and Brett is arrested, but it all culminates in a surprise: Mia decides to drop all charges.  Bent on keeping her safe, Olivia decides to hide in the couple’s home, and ends up discovering an entirely different case of spousal abuse—and murder—altogether.  Ahh, the tradition of suddenly springing a surprise when you think it’s all over…

Also appearing as guests are Mike Farrell (Desperate Housewives) and Brenda Blethlyn (Atonement).  Law & Order: Special Victims Unit returns tonight from 10pm on NBC.  Oh, and if you’ve missed the episode from three weeks ago—that one titled “Retro”—then you can catch it again this Saturday, also from 10pm.  That’s a double dose for you.
